tower bridge 980961 960 720

Located in Berkshire, England, Slough is often overlooked as a tourist destination due to its close proximity to London. However, this bustling town has its own unique charm and plenty of hidden gems waiting to be explored. From historical landmarks to tranquil parks, here are the best places to visit in Slough.

Windsor Castle

No visit to Slough would be complete without a trip to Windsor Castle, one of the most iconic attractions in the United Kingdom. Steeped in history, this magnificent castle has been home to British monarchs for over 900 years. Explore the State Apartments, Queen Mary’s Dolls’ House, and St. George’s Chapel, which is the final resting place of many kings and queens. The Changing of the Guard ceremony is also a must-see spectacle that takes place within the castle grounds.

Langley Park

For nature lovers, Langley Park is a true hidden gem. Spanning over 100 acres, this picturesque park offers beautiful woodlands, serene lakes, and well-maintained gardens. Take a leisurely stroll along the numerous walking trails, have a picnic by the lake, or simply relax in the tranquil surroundings. The park is also home to a collection of exotic trees and plants, making it a popular spot for birdwatching.

See also  A Hidden Gem: Exploring the Best Places to Visit in Progresu, Romania

The Curve

If you’re looking for some cultural enrichment, head to The Curve in Slough town center. This award-winning library and cultural center offers a range of activities and events for all ages. Explore the extensive book collection, attend a live performance in the auditorium, or participate in various workshops and exhibitions. The Curve also hosts regular art displays and interactive installations, making it a hub of creativity in Slough.

Stoke Poges Memorial Gardens

Stoke Poges Memorial Gardens is a serene and picturesque cemetery located in Slough. Although it may seem an unusual choice for a visit, this hidden gem boasts stunning landscaped gardens, tall trees, and peaceful paths. Take a tranquil walk among the beautifully manicured grounds, pay your respects at the memorial, or simply find solace in the serene atmosphere. The gardens offer a tranquil escape from the hustle and bustle of city life.

Slough Museum

To learn more about the history and heritage of Slough, a visit to the Slough Museum is a must. Located in a Grade II listed Georgian mansion, this museum showcases the town’s rich past through a collection of artifacts, photographs, and interactive displays. From the industrial revolution to the present day, the exhibits offer an immersive experience into the evolving landscape and culture of Slough.

See also  Exploring the Exquisite Charm of Guiseley: A Hidden Gem in the United Kingdom

Black Park Country Park

Just a short drive away from Slough, Black Park Country Park is a fantastic spot for outdoor enthusiasts. This expansive park features walking and cycling trails, serene lakes, and lush woodlands. With a play area for children, a Go Ape treetop adventure course, and a café for refreshments, there’s something for everyone to enjoy. It’s the perfect place to escape the hustle and bustle of the town and immerse yourself in nature.


Slough may not be the most obvious choice for a vacation in the United Kingdom, but this hidden gem has plenty to offer visitors. From the historical grandeur of Windsor Castle to the tranquil beauty of Langley Park, there’s something for everyone here. So, next time you find yourself in the vicinity of Slough, take the time to explore these hidden gems and discover the unique charm of this bustling town.

Originally posted 2023-07-30 01:28:56.

Similar Posts